====Super Mario series====
=====''Super Mario World''=====
[[File:Beta Super Mario World Rocky Wrench.png|thumb|left]]
Sprites found in development materials of ''[[Super Mario World]]'' include sprites for Rocky Wrench meant for the [[Sunken Ghost Ship]], suggesting that they would have appeared as enemies in said level. These sprites heavily resemble Rocky Wrench's ''Super Mario Bros. 3'' sprites, though they have a separate color scheme compared to that game. Rocky Wrenches were eventually scrapped for unknown reasons. Additionally, the ''Super Mario World'' style in ''Super Mario Maker'' also uses original sprites instead of the unused Rocky Wrench sprites from ''Super Mario World''.

=====''Super Mario Odyssey''=====
[[File:SMO Concept Art Broodals (Koopa Troop).png|thumb|300px|The scrapped Powered-Up Regular Enemy bosses planned for ''Super Mario Odyssey'']]
{{media link|SMO Concept Art Broodals (Koopa Troop).png|One piece of concept artwork}} for the [[Broodals]] from ''[[The Art of Super Mario Odyssey]]'' labeled "Powered-Up Regular Enemy Designs" depicts a [[Powered-Up Rocky Wrench]] boss based on their original design rather than the modern one, having the shell, taller orange body, white-rimmed sunglasses, round snout, and sharp teeth as the classic depictions of Rocky Wrench. This design along with the rest were scrapped due to being too similar to the [[Koopalings]], with the Rocky Wrench later being replaced with [[Rango]]. However, the book states that this design along with the other Powered-Up enemies have a chance to return in a future game someday.

====''Super Mario World 2: Yoshi's Island''====
[[File:YI RockyWrench.png|thumb||left]]
[[File:SMRPG2 Concept Artwork 1.jpg|thumb|right|250px|The ''Super Mario RPG 2'' concept art featuring Rocky Wrench]]
Sprites found in development materials of ''[[Super Mario World 2: Yoshi's Island]]'' include sprites and animations for Rocky Wrench as well as potential log vehicles, but they were again removed. Their head shape and sunglasses is reminiscent of Monty Moles' designs for ''Super Mario World'', though they are still taller and lack some of the white patches. Uniquely, Rocky Wrenches also seem to have originally been planned to walk inside logs, as well as riding log cars similar to the Flintmobile from {{wp|The Flintstones}} (though they were still going to keep their wrench throwing tactics as well). Only their wrench and possible lower body exist within [[List of Super Mario World 2: Yoshi's Island beta elements|unused graphics]] in the final release. [[Snifit]]s were also alternately considered to utilize the vehicles designed for Rocky Wrenches, though this was later scrapped.

====''Paper Mario'' / ''Super Mario RPG 2''====
In concept art for ''[[Paper Mario]]'' (back when it was referred to as ''Super Mario RPG 2'' in development), Rocky Wrenches would have had appeared as an enemy. However, Rocky Wrenches were completely absent in the final version of the game.
